What is Asbestos Lung Cancer?
Asbestos lung cancer mostly describes lung cancer that establishes due to exposure to asbestos fibers. When breathed in, these fibers can get lodged in the lungs, resulting in swelling and scar tissue development gradually. This damage increases the risk of establishing lung cancer, especially among individuals with long-term exposure such as those operating in shipyards, building websites, or markets that traditionally used asbestos extensively.
Health Risks of Asbestos ExposureCommon Health Problems Associated with AsbestosHealth IssueDescriptionAsbestosisA persistent lung condition triggered by breathing in asbestos fibers.Lung CancerA deadly growth in the lungs frequently linked to asbestos exposure.MesotheliomaAn unusual and aggressive cancer mainly related to asbestos.Pleural DiseaseConditions affecting the pleura, the lining around the lungs.
Crucial Note: The risk of developing lung cancer is substantially heightened for smokers who have actually been exposed to asbestos.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. What is asbestos lung cancer?
Asbestos lung cancer is a kind of lung cancer that can establish after prolonged exposure to asbestos fibers. It is often diagnosed along with other diseases linked to asbestos exposure.
2. The length of time does it consider asbestos-related diseases to develop?
Symptoms of asbestos-related diseases can take several years, in some cases even decades, to manifest after initial exposure.
